I sent this off to my state and national MPs this morning: 


Dear Members of Parliament,

I wish to point the transphobic aspects of an article arguing against transwomen's inclusion in elite sports. The article can be found at https://theconversation.com/many-sports-are-tightening-their-transgender-policies-can-inclusion-co-exist-with-fairness-physical-safety-and-integrity-231597, and the concerns I have (and have advised to The Conversation), are:

  • inadequate consideration of whether the characteristics being examined actually result in actual benefits; 
  • the consistent and incorrect conflation of cismale (no female hormones) and transwoman (often years of female hormones) - not to mention those trans people who transition early with puberty blockers and thus do not have the physical characteristics being discussed; 
  • the range of ciswomen's physical characteristics - which means many ciswomen elite athletes may be well above the average (there is a photo of US ciswomen basketball athletes standing beside a team of ciswomen basketballers from another nation which well illustrates that), 
  • the issue of safety (including from "othering", harassment and assault) of transwomen - which is likely to be worsened by this article (the safety of transwomen should be of equal consideration); and 
  • that the "open" category could only be fair if it includes at least three categories and thus is utterly nonsensical.

In addition, this article is likely to have a chilling effect on transwomen participating in sport, as it will encourage transphobes at the non-elite level, and thus increase hostility towards transwomen.

I am appalled that this article slipped through The Conversation's editing processes, and am concerned that it might be given ANY consideration.
